In the sprawling archipelago of Indonesia—home to over 270 million people—demography is destiny. With more than half of the population under the age of 30, the nation is not just a political or economic heavyweight in Southeast Asia; it is a cultural petri dish. Indonesian youth culture is no longer a footnote in global trends; it is a primary engine driving music, fashion, spirituality, and digital commerce across the region.
